X-Git-Url: http://koha-dev.rot13.org:8081/gitweb/?a=blobdiff_plain;f=admin%2Foai_set_mappings.pl;h=18a48bbe94efb906730a71865afa518ab9211a3e;hb=48298fe4942ba37f59aa42d7155552c5b61974cf;hp=1a9762c767a9746dfa18532874575987c2dc67c7;hpb=31a0ed0a43bb4ecfde0b762eb6e654c51da6f66e;p=koha_fer diff --git a/admin/oai_set_mappings.pl b/admin/oai_set_mappings.pl index 1a9762c767..18a48bbe94 100755 --- a/admin/oai_set_mappings.pl +++ b/admin/oai_set_mappings.pl @@ -55,15 +55,17 @@ my $op = $input->param('op'); if($op && $op eq "save") { my @marcfields = $input->param('marcfield'); my @marcsubfields = $input->param('marcsubfield'); + my @operators = $input->param('operator'); my @marcvalues = $input->param('marcvalue'); my @mappings; my $i = 0; while($i < @marcfields and $i < @marcsubfields and $i < @marcvalues) { - if($marcfields[$i] and $marcsubfields[$i] and $marcvalues[$i]) { + if($marcfields[$i] and $marcsubfields[$i]) { push @mappings, { marcfield => $marcfields[$i], marcsubfield => $marcsubfields[$i], + operator => $operators[$i], marcvalue => $marcvalues[$i] }; }